Role Overview
We are seeking mathematicians with deep training in rigorous proof construction and hands-on experience with formal proof languages, especially Lean. This role sits at the intersection of mathematics and computer science, focusing on translating human-written mathematical arguments into precise, machine-verifiable formalizations.
What You’ll Do:
- Translate informal mathematical proofs into Lean (and related proof systems) with an emphasis on clarity, structure, and correctness.
- Analyze generic and domain-specific proofs, identifying gaps, hidden assumptions, and formalizable sub-structures.
- Construct formalizations that test the limits of existing proof assistants, especially where tools struggle or fail.
- Collaborate with researchers to design, refine, and evaluate strategies for improving formal verification pipelines.
- Develop highly readable, reproducible proof scripts aligned with mathematical best practices and proof assistant idioms.
- Provide guidance on proof decomposition, lemma selection, and structuring techniques for formal models.
Sample Work You Might Do:
- Formalize classical proofs and compare machine-verifiable structures against textbook arguments.
- Investigate where automated provers break down, and articulate why (complexity, missing lemmas, insufficient libraries, etc.).
- Create Lean proofs that reveal deeper patterns or generalizations implicit in the original mathematics.
